We are seeking a motivated and dedicated Property Manager to join our team. This role involves managing a shared portfolio of approximately 350 residential properties whilst providing excellent customer service to both Landlords and Tenants. The ideal candidate will have a keen eye for detail, strong communication skills, and a passion for the property market.
Key Responsibilities- Manage a portfolio of residential rental properties
- Act as main point of contact for landlords and tenants
- Ensure compliance with all housing legislation and safety requirements
- Manage tenant onboarding, renewals, and end-of-tenancy processes
- Arrange property inspections and follow up on issues
- Arrange and oversee property maintenance and repairs
- Instruct and manage contractors and suppliers
- Manage rent arrears
- Prepare landlord statements and financial reports
- Handle tenant queries
- Ensure deposits are correctly protected and administered
- Serve notices and manage tenancy breaches where required
- Coordinate inventories, check-ins, and check-outs
- Advise landlords on compliance and property performance
- Maintain accurate property and tenancy records
- Deliver high levels of customer service and professionalism
- Handle deposit returns
- Handle rent insurance/eviction claims
- Serve Section notices
